Taxonomic Classification
| Rank | Doum Palm | Kaapori Capuchin |
|---|---|---|
| Kingdom | Plantae (Plants) | Animalia (Animals) |
| Phylum | Magnoliophyta (Flowering Plants) | Chordata (Chordates) |
| Class | Liliopsida (Monocots) | Mammalia (Mammals) |
| Order | Arecales (Arecales) | Primates (Primates) |
| Family | Arecaceae | Cebidae |
| Genus | Hyphaene | Cebus |
| Species | Hyphaene compressa | Cebus kaapori |
